Original Description
The painting Bedroom of Elisabeth de Calmette, Liselund Manor House by Peter Vilhelm Ilsted captures an exquisite Danish interior suffused with quiet elegance and soft, diffused light. Ilsted, a master of intimism—a style akin to the Danish counterpart of French Intimism—elevates mundane domestic scenes into poetic reflections on light, serenity, and refined living. The artwork portrays the bedroom at Liselund, an 18th-century neoclassical manor on the island of Møn, rendered with Ilsted’s signature precision in capturing textures—velvet drapes, polished wood, and delicate porcelain. The subdued palette and meticulous attention to detail reflect the Golden Age of Danish Painting (1800–1850), where artists like Vilhelm Hammershøi and Ilsted himself redefined interior scenes as meditative studies of light and space. This work stands as a testament to Ilsted’s mastery in blending realism with atmospheric depth, cementing his legacy in Nordic art history.
